It’s Hot. Here’s What We’re Actually Drinking to Stay Hydrated

adminBy adminJuly 31, 2026No Comments5 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r WhatsApp VKontakte Email
It’s Hot. Here’s What We’re Actually Drinking to Stay Hydrated
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email


At a certain point in summer, your emotional support water bottle starts to feel a little uninspiring. The days are hotter, we are outside more, and between workouts, travel, beach days, and simply existing through a heat wave, staying hydrated suddenly requires a little more attention. The NIH recommends drinking extra fluids during hot weather, but that does not mean every sip has to come from the same bottle of lukewarm water you have been carrying around since breakfast.

This summer, we are mixing things up. There is cold pressed fruit hydration straight from the fridge, an electrolyte formula made for the days we are actually sweating, coconut water we will never stop buying, and even a beauty focused drink that makes hydration feel suspiciously close to skincare.

Consider this our current summer hydration rotation.

Pressed Hydration+ Watermelon Dragon Fruit

This is exactly what we want waiting in the fridge when the temperature starts climbing. Pressed Hydration+ Watermelon Dragon Fruit brings together coconut water, watermelon, dragon fruit, lemon, and lime with six essential electrolytes, including sodium, potassium, magnesium, calcium, zinc, and chloride. There is also 450 milligrams of L glutamine in the formula.

What makes it especially right for summer is that it drinks more like something you would genuinely crave on a hot afternoon than a traditional sports drink. It is bright, fruity, and best served cold. We would grab this after a workout, throw one in a beach cooler, or reach for it during the afternoon slump when plain water simply is not inspiring anyone.

Best for: Hot afternoons, post workout hydration, and anyone who wants their electrolytes to taste like summer.

Gnarly Hydrate

For the days when summer involves considerably more activity than lying beside a pool, we are reaching for Gnarly Hydrate. This one is firmly rooted in performance, with a full spectrum electrolyte formula designed around sustained activity and sweat. The current formula includes sodium, potassium, and magnesium, contains no artificial colors or sweeteners, and is NSF Certified for Sport.

That makes it the one we would pack for a long hike, outdoor workout, bike ride, or any summer adventure where you know you are going to come back considerably sweatier than you left. The flavors also make it considerably more fun than the typical serious sports nutrition formula, with options including Orange Pineapple, Raspberry, Ruby Red Grapefruit, Lemonade, Salted Margarita, and Piña Colada.

Best for: Hikes, outdoor workouts, long active days, and the people who actually earn their electrolytes.

Pique B•T Fountain

This is hydration for the person whose wellness routine has somehow merged completely with their skincare routine. Pique B•T Fountain combines electrolytes and minerals with hyaluronic acid and ceramides, positioning hydration as part of a broader beauty from within ritual.

We like it because it brings something completely different to the hydration conversation. This is not the packet we are necessarily grabbing before a marathon. It is the one we mix over ice in the morning because we already think about moisture everywhere else in our beauty routine, so why stop at the bathroom cabinet?

Best for: The beauty obsessed, morning wellness rituals, and anyone who likes their hydration with a side of skincare.

Harmless Harvest Organic Coconut Water

There are trends in hydration, and then there is coconut water, which we will happily keep coming back to every summer.

Harmless Harvest remains one of our refrigerator staples, whether we are drinking the original organic coconut water straight from the bottle or reaching for one of the brand’s other variations, including coconut water with watermelon and sparkling coconut water.

There is something about an ice cold bottle after being outside all day that just hits differently. We also love using it as the liquid base for smoothies or pouring it over plenty of ice with a squeeze of fresh lime when we want something that feels a little more intentional than opening another bottle of water.

Best for: Beach bags, morning walks, smoothies, and the coconut water loyalists among us.

Plant People Wonder Hydrate

Okay, technically we are not drinking this one. We are chewing it.

Plant People’s Wonder Hydrate takes the electrolyte category in a completely different direction with a sugar free, lychee flavored gummy. The formula includes electrolyte minerals such as magnesium and potassium, along with vitamin C and prebiotic fiber.

We would not swap these in for actual fluid intake, obviously, but as an addition to a summer routine, the format is undeniably convenient. No shaker bottle. No powder mysteriously accumulating at the bottom of your tote. Just a hydration adjacent supplement you can keep at your desk or throw into a carry on.

And frankly, we appreciate any wellness product that understands we do not always want another powder.

Best for: Travel, handbags, supplement maximalists, and anyone officially over mixing things into water.

Loonen

And then there are the days when what we really want is just very, very good water.

Loonen takes a more considered approach to bottled water, starting with spring sourced water that is filtered, tested, and bottled exclusively in glass. The brand currently offers both still and sparkling versions.

We particularly like the sparkling bottles for summer dinners, long lunches, and those late afternoons when we want something cold and fizzy without opening another functional beverage. Add citrus, fresh mint, or cucumber and suddenly drinking water feels significantly less like a task.

Best for: The dinner table, poolside lunches, and anyone whose preferred beverage aesthetic is very nice European hotel.
